#13724e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13724e is composed of 7.5% red, 44.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.6%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 157.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 26.1%. #13724e color hex could be obtained by blending #26e49c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#13724e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13724e has RGB values of R:19, G:114,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 1274446.

Shades and Tints of #13724e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d09 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#13724e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414443 is the less saturated color, while #048152 is the most saturated one.
